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 10 Oct 2014 03:44:17 +0000 (UTC)
From:      Steve Wills <swills@FreeBSD.org>
To:        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org
Subject:   svn commit: r370565 - in head/net/syncthing: . files
Message-ID:  <201410100344.s9A3iHci000800@svn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: swills
Date: Fri Oct 10 03:44:17 2014
New Revision: 370565
URL: https://svnweb.freebsd.org/changeset/ports/370565
QAT: https://qat.redports.org/buildarchive/r370565/

Log:
  net/syncthing: update to 0.10.0

Added:
  head/net/syncthing/files/patch-build.go   (contents, props changed)
Modified:
  head/net/syncthing/Makefile
  head/net/syncthing/distinfo
  head/net/syncthing/files/patch-upgrade__upgrade_supported.go

Modified: head/net/syncthing/Makefile
==============================================================================
--- head/net/syncthing/Makefile	Fri Oct 10 03:43:44 2014	(r370564)
+++ head/net/syncthing/Makefile	Fri Oct 10 03:44:17 2014	(r370565)
@@ -2,33 +2,10 @@
 # $FreeBSD$
 
 PORTNAME=	syncthing
-PORTVERSION=	0.9.18
-PORTREVISION=	2
+PORTVERSION=	0.10.0
 CATEGORIES=	net
-MASTER_SITES=	https://github.com/${PORTNAME}/${PORTNAME}/archive/v${PORTVERSION}.tar.gz?dummy=/:group1 \
-		https://bitbucket.org/kardianos/osext/get/:group2 \
-		LOCAL/swills:group3 \
-		LOCAL/swills:group4 \
-		LOCAL/swills:group5 \
-		https://codeload.github.com/bkaradzic/go-lz4/legacy.tar.gz/93a831d?dummy=/:group6 \
-		https://codeload.github.com/calmh/xdr/legacy.tar.gz/e1714bb?dummy=/:group7 \
-		https://codeload.github.com/juju/ratelimit/legacy.tar.gz/f9f36d1?dummy=/:group8 \
-		https://codeload.github.com/syndtr/goleveldb/legacy.tar.gz/9bca75c?dummy=/:group9 \
-		https://codeload.github.com/vitrun/qart/legacy.tar.gz/ccb109c?dummy=/:group10 \
-		LOCAL/swills:group11 \
-		LOCAL/swills:group12
-DISTFILES=	${PORTNAME}-${PORTVERSION}${EXTRACT_SUFX}:group1 \
-		5d3ddcf53a50${EXTRACT_SUFX}:group2 \
-		text.go-d65bffbc88a1${EXTRACT_SUFX}:group3 \
-		snappy-go-12e4b4183793${EXTRACT_SUFX}:group4 \
-		crypto.go-31393df5baea${EXTRACT_SUFX}:group5 \
-		bkaradzic-go-lz4-93a831d${EXTRACT_SUFX}:group6 \
-		calmh-xdr-e1714bb${EXTRACT_SUFX}:group7 \
-		juju-ratelimit-f9f36d1${EXTACT_SUFX}:group8 \
-		syndtr-goleveldb-9bca75c${EXTRACT_SUFX}:group9 \
-		vitrun-qart-ccb109c${EXTRACT_SUFX}:group10 \
-		tools.go-7a99b946364f${EXTRACT_SUFX}:group11 \
-		net.go-90e232e2462d${EXTRACT_SUFX}:group12
+MASTER_SITES=	https://github.com/${PORTNAME}/${PORTNAME}/archive/v${PORTVERSION}.tar.gz?dummy=/
+DISTNAME=	${PORTNAME}-${PORTVERSION}
 
 MAINTAINER=	swills@FreeBSD.org
 COMMENT=	Encrypted file sync tool
@@ -43,40 +20,20 @@ USERS=		syncthing
 GROUPS=		syncthing
 
 post-patch:
-	${REINPLACE_CMD} -e 's|%%PORTVERSION%%|${PORTVERSION}|g' ${WRKSRC}/build.sh
-	cd ${WRKSRC} ; \
-		${MKDIR} src/code.google.com/p \
-			src/bitbucket.org/kardianos \
-			src/github.com/bkaradzic \
-			src/github.com/calmh \
-			src/github.com/juju \
-			src/github.com/syndtr \
-			src/github.com/vitrun \
-			src/github.com/syncthing/syncthing ; \
-		${MV} ${WRKDIR}/kardianos-osext-5d3ddcf53a50 ${WRKSRC}/src/bitbucket.org/kardianos/osext ; \
-		${MV} ${WRKDIR}/crypto.go-31393df5baea/ src/code.google.com/p/go.crypto ; \
-		${MV} ${WRKDIR}/snappy-go-12e4b4183793 src/code.google.com/p/snappy-go ; \
-		${MV} ${WRKDIR}/text.go-d65bffbc88a1 src/code.google.com/p/go.text ; \
-		${MV} ${WRKDIR}/tools.go-7a99b946364f src/code.google.com/p/go.tools ; \
-		${MV} ${WRKDIR}/net.go-90e232e2462d src/code.google.com/p/go.net ; \
-		${MV} ${WRKDIR}/bkaradzic-go-lz4-93a831d src/github.com/bkaradzic/go-lz4 ; \
-		${MV} ${WRKDIR}/calmh-xdr-e1714bb src/github.com/calmh/xdr ; \
-		${MV} ${WRKDIR}/juju-ratelimit-f9f36d1 src/github.com/juju/ratelimit ; \
-		${MV} ${WRKDIR}/syndtr-goleveldb-9bca75c src/github.com/syndtr/goleveldb ; \
-		${MV} ${WRKDIR}/vitrun-qart-ccb109c src/github.com/vitrun/qart ; \
-		${CP} -r lamport luhn beacon scanner versioner files \
-		protocol auto config discover events logger model osutil ignore stats fnmatch cmd \
-		upgrade upnp src/github.com/syncthing/syncthing
+	cd ${WRKSRC} ; ${MKDIR} src/github.com/${PORTNAME}/${PORTNAME} ; \
+		${MV} .gitignore CONTRIBUTING.md CONTRIBUTORS Godeps LICENSE \
+		README.md assets build.go build.sh check-contrib.sh cmd gui \
+		internal protocol test src/github.com/${PORTNAME}/${PORTNAME}
 
 do-build:
 	# timestamp here refers to source, not build time
-	cd ${WRKSRC} ; ${SETENV} GOPATH=${WRKSRC} go build -ldflags "-w -X main.Version v${PORTVERSION} -X main.BuildStamp 1411588890 -X main.BuildUser ${USER} -X main.BuildHost ${HOST}" github.com/syncthing/syncthing/cmd/syncthing
+	cd ${WRKSRC}/src/github.com/${PORTNAME}/${PORTNAME} ; ${SETENV} GOPATH=${WRKSRC} go run build.go
 
 do-install:
-	${INSTALL_PROGRAM} ${WRKSRC}/syncthing ${STAGEDIR}${PREFIX}/bin/
+	${INSTALL_PROGRAM} ${WRKSRC}/src/github.com/${PORTNAME}/${PORTNAME}/bin/syncthing ${STAGEDIR}${PREFIX}/bin/
 	${MKDIR} ${STAGEDIR}${DOCSDIR}
 .for x in CONTRIBUTORS LICENSE README.md
-	${INSTALL_MAN} ${WRKSRC}/${x} ${STAGEDIR}${DOCSDIR}
+	${INSTALL_MAN} ${WRKSRC}/src/github.com/${PORTNAME}/${PORTNAME}/${x} ${STAGEDIR}${DOCSDIR}
 .endfor
 
 .include <bsd.port.mk>

Modified: head/net/syncthing/distinfo
==============================================================================
--- head/net/syncthing/distinfo	Fri Oct 10 03:43:44 2014	(r370564)
+++ head/net/syncthing/distinfo	Fri Oct 10 03:44:17 2014	(r370565)
@@ -1,24 +1,2 @@
-SHA256 (syncthing-0.9.18.tar.gz) = 4ce72566dc59101683371b85fc905baf3bf23749f7d077443e39c37cc2ac7274
-SIZE (syncthing-0.9.18.tar.gz) = 1942823
-SHA256 (5d3ddcf53a50.tar.gz) = d39ed6aa63c76b62d6cd5850128f7205f0d983ffbb78f121afbd4a3c85937587
-SIZE (5d3ddcf53a50.tar.gz) = 3060
-SHA256 (text.go-d65bffbc88a1.tar.gz) = c78ad1d2bbd296ccddba7c86e4250f66490a3479c068a78a520fd42d68e0aa9d
-SIZE (text.go-d65bffbc88a1.tar.gz) = 3234551
-SHA256 (snappy-go-12e4b4183793.tar.gz) = fb220046f526122a219aa22f34edbdd236343c4cf3439e79a6d56a145a006194
-SIZE (snappy-go-12e4b4183793.tar.gz) = 7785
-SHA256 (crypto.go-31393df5baea.tar.gz) = ad51b826e2198cc99a0b5fa38077bab8e1c44dc3e8a2e65ab2289f06f4bb31f3
-SIZE (crypto.go-31393df5baea.tar.gz) = 850477
-SHA256 (bkaradzic-go-lz4-93a831d.tar.gz) = f11a2a4eadb525360dba2517abcbcb1a18d67f606a1311b8263fb5a0bca67e5b
-SIZE (bkaradzic-go-lz4-93a831d.tar.gz) = 232907
-SHA256 (calmh-xdr-e1714bb.tar.gz) = 354133594fc70dac499a44ffd6d857f1f730345f8db3d07def4e38daec5ec791
-SIZE (calmh-xdr-e1714bb.tar.gz) = 9250
-SHA256 (juju-ratelimit-f9f36d1) = d2117682d9ef68764cfdd4de51b4d150cd2c6c0b6a9fcaa50d5891443b42285a
-SIZE (juju-ratelimit-f9f36d1) = 7382
-SHA256 (syndtr-goleveldb-9bca75c.tar.gz) = 68353a47e33b81d47c3cb0c3058011a391a5d7a65e20c7cf5b1d8e08a19d129f
-SIZE (syndtr-goleveldb-9bca75c.tar.gz) = 112667
-SHA256 (vitrun-qart-ccb109c.tar.gz) = 6daeaea6334827e56daa82d601df9bca1bb48dd9b1deb2f8708ffb3867afd112
-SIZE (vitrun-qart-ccb109c.tar.gz) = 23243
-SHA256 (tools.go-7a99b946364f.tar.gz) = 6b67d2cd7b06c197296f0d89bd623bf4b4c518ce7962268cec1ecdbe9a228757
-SIZE (tools.go-7a99b946364f.tar.gz) = 1636949
-SHA256 (net.go-90e232e2462d.tar.gz) = 5bac84792244e0b5d12d573cbe9234e49d1fc54095bf32ebbe8e0419f0378249
-SIZE (net.go-90e232e2462d.tar.gz) = 391242
+SHA256 (syncthing-0.10.0.tar.gz) = 99c1460ba52e03cfdb349a3d2d41bb5cdd65bc722d9a0f02b9bf0cd3dee21e6e
+SIZE (syncthing-0.10.0.tar.gz) = 2952791

Added: head/net/syncthing/files/patch-build.go
==============================================================================
--- /dev/null	00:00:00 1970	(empty, because file is newly added)
+++ head/net/syncthing/files/patch-build.go	Fri Oct 10 03:44:17 2014	(r370565)
@@ -0,0 +1,23 @@
+--- build.go.orig	2014-10-10 03:17:54.000000000 +0000
++++ build.go	2014-10-10 03:21:21.000000000 +0000
+@@ -299,18 +299,11 @@
+ }
+ 
+ func version() string {
+-	v := run("git", "describe", "--always", "--dirty")
+-	v = versionRe.ReplaceAllFunc(v, func(s []byte) []byte {
+-		s[0] = '+'
+-		return s
+-	})
+-	return string(v)
++	return string("v0.10.0")
+ }
+ 
+ func buildStamp() int64 {
+-	bs := run("git", "show", "-s", "--format=%ct")
+-	s, _ := strconv.ParseInt(string(bs), 10, 64)
+-	return s
++	return 1412769521
+ }
+ 
+ func buildUser() string {

Modified: head/net/syncthing/files/patch-upgrade__upgrade_supported.go
==============================================================================
--- head/net/syncthing/files/patch-upgrade__upgrade_supported.go	Fri Oct 10 03:43:44 2014	(r370564)
+++ head/net/syncthing/files/patch-upgrade__upgrade_supported.go	Fri Oct 10 03:44:17 2014	(r370565)
@@ -1,5 +1,5 @@
---- upgrade/upgrade_supported.go.orig	2014-09-28 21:24:06.335428814 +0000
-+++ upgrade/upgrade_supported.go	2014-09-28 21:24:59.699424791 +0000
+--- internal/upgrade/upgrade_supported.go.orig	2014-09-28 21:24:06.335428814 +0000
++++ internal/upgrade/upgrade_supported.go	2014-09-28 21:24:59.699424791 +0000
 @@ -70,6 +70,7 @@
  
  // Returns the latest release, including prereleases or not depending on the argument



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201410100344.s9A3iHci000800>